Why Flexible Energy Storage Matters Now
As global energy demands grow 3.8% annually (World Energy Council 2023), the flexible energy storage equipment industry has emerged as the linchpin connecting renewable energy sources to reliable power grids. From solar farms in Arizona to microgrids in Singapore, these systems are rewriting the rules of energy distribution.

Three Game-Changing Applications
- Wind-Solar Hybrid Systems: "Our 20MW facility in Texas reduced curtailment by 63% using modular battery arrays," reports EK SOLAR's project lead.
- EV Charging Networks: Seoul's new fast-charging stations leverage liquid-cooled battery buffers to handle demand spikes
- Industrial Load Shifting: A German cement plant cut energy costs 27% using phase-change thermal storage
"The true value isn't just storage capacity - it's how quickly and efficiently you can deploy that energy," notes Dr. Emma Lin, MIT Energy Initiative
Emerging Technologies to Watch
While lithium-ion still dominates (68% of installations), new players are entering the ring:
- Graphene-enhanced supercapacitors (8-second response time)
- Sand-based thermal storage (4x cheaper than molten salt)
- Hydrogen hybrid systems for 72h+ backup
Want to know which solution fits your needs? Here's the kicker: Most operators combine 2-3 technologies for optimal performance. A recent California microgrid project blended flow batteries with flywheels, achieving 99.991% uptime.
Cost Comparison: Traditional vs. Flexible Systems
- Peaker Plants: $350-500/kW
- Lithium-Ion ESS: $280-400/kW
- Modular Thermal Storage: $150-220/kW
The Road Ahead: 2024-2030 Predictions
Three trends will reshape the industry:
- AI-driven predictive storage (34% efficiency gains projected)
- Containerized "storage as service" models
- Second-life EV battery deployments
